Title: | Effectiveness of Nurse Led Bundle Care Therapy on Symptoms Stress and Quality of Life among Women with Pelvic organ Prolapse |

Abstract: | Pelvic organ Prolapse (POP) is a common disorder often associated with symptoms such as newlinevaginal bulging, pelvic heaviness, bothersome Micturition and defecation symptoms as well as newlinesexual dysfunction, often with a negative impact on quality of life. Mostly benign, but POP is newlinedistressing and disabling The multi factorial Patho physiology may be the cause of associated newlinesymptoms such as bladder, bowel, sexual, and even painful symptoms. Nurse led Bundle care newlineTherapy as one of the Conservative treatment options have therefore gained interest and many newlinewomen with POP prefer Bundle care especially if they have minor symptoms. Materials and newlinemethods; A Quasi experimental study using POP impact, stress and Quality of life assessment newlinescales was performed among 320 women with Pelvic Organ Prolapse .PFMT ,Kegel s exercise newlineand Yoga therapy were given to women as bundle care. Results; POP symptoms decreased from newline44.93 to 28.37, Stress level from 22.84 to 15.21 and QOL affecting issues reduced from 28.99 to newline19.76.Selected socio demographic variables like education, residence and food habit of women newlinefrom the experimental group reported significant reduction of symptoms after the newlineintervention(P=0.001).Summary;The experimental group s problems decreased overall up to newline40% from pre to post testing, demonstrating the Bundle care Therapy s positive effect while the newlinecontrol group with the routine hospital care exhibited no change. Conclusion ;Nurse Led clinics newlinehave revealed both clinically sound and perceived benefits to the women with POP symptoms, by newlinefocusing on promoting quality health traits and putting emphasis on POP management through newlinebundle care therapy. newlineKey words. newlinePOP symptoms, Stress,Quality of Life, Nurse Led bundle care therapy newline |
